How are branch circuit conductors sized
WebSizing conductors for equipment involves referencing the usual tables that pertain to conductor sizing, such as 310.15 (B) (16), 310.15 (B) (2) (a), 310.15 (B) (3) (a) and 310.15 (B) (3) (c). It also involves referencing the usual sections, such as 110.14 (C), 210.19 (A), 210.23 and 240.4. WebBranch circuit conductors must have an ampacity of the rating of the branch circuit and not less than the load to be served (210.19). The minimum size branch circuit conductor that can be used is 14 AWG (210.19). For exceptions to minimum conductor size, see 210.19.
